The secret is in the design: no-tool assembly furniture relies on friction and smart connectors to hold everything together. The 4-way modular connectors are shaped to grip the paper tubes tightly, creating a stable structure without a single bolt. And because it's detachable eco furniture , taking it apart is just as easy—perfect for moving day. No more wrestling with stuck screws or breaking pieces trying to disassemble; just gently pull the connectors apart, pack it back into the flat pack box, and you're ready to go.

Caring for Your Paper TV Stand: Tips for Longevity

With a little care, your paper TV stand can last for years. Here's how to keep it in top shape:

  • Avoid prolonged water exposure : While it's water-resistant, it's not waterproof. Wipe up spills immediately, and don't place it near a leaky window or humidifier.
  • Clean with a dry or slightly damp cloth : Dust regularly with a microfiber cloth. For stuck-on grime, use a damp cloth (not soaking wet) and dry immediately.
  • Don't overload it : Check the manufacturer's weight limit (most paper TV stands can hold 40-60kg) and stick to it. No stacking your entire book collection on top unless it's rated for that weight.
  • Protect from direct sunlight : Prolonged sun exposure can fade the paper. If your stand is near a window, consider a curtain or blind to shield it.
  • Store properly when not in use : If you're moving or storing it, take it apart and pack it in the original flat pack box. Keep it in a dry, cool place—avoid basements or attics with high humidity.

Follow these tips, and your paper TV stand will stay sturdy and stylish for years to come. And when you are ready to replace it? Simply recycle the components—no guilt, no waste.
